Dundee United boss Craig Levein is delighted with his capture of winger Danny Swanson.
Swanson, 20, signed a contract until 2011 after sealing his move from Berwick Rangers on Wednesday.
The midfielder will move to Tannadice in January and Levein said he was confident the player would bolster the squad.
"We've got a solid base to from in midfield now, with the likes of Morgaro Gomis and Prince Bauben, so we've got the defensive side of it covered," he said.
"But Danny is more of an attacking player. Willo Flood is in there just now, but he's on loan and we have to be careful we don't get into a position where him going back leaves us with a big gap.
"We're looking ahead a bit so he's coming in to train with us to get to know the lads.
"He's a bit subdued at the moment, but that's to be expected and he'll get up to speed quickly."
